Woodgate and Clark is hiring a Desktop Property Claims Handler to manage a portfolio of low to medium complexity property damage claims from FNOL through to settlement.
You will learn coverage assessment, negotiation, and end-to-end claims handling within a TPA setting.
This role is ideal for an organised, empathetic individual early in their claims career, with structured training, coaching, and quality assurance to build a solid foundation in regulatory standards and customer service.
